Transaction 84d45d4f359880e08fc5975f9e4eecd64c52640d49522537e0c52c54a897ba88
1 Input
1 Output
-
84d45d4f359880e08fc5975f9e4eecd64c52640d49522537e0c52c54a897ba88:0
- value
- 423050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d770836baab2714b25e05cf91f58bf139db9272 OP_EQUAL
- address
- 3JxpEJ1AER5otihECTeZCiHKbJ8JNcxuWc